Senior Automation Engineer (8–12 years)
FIS View all jobs
- Aundh, Maharashtra Pune, Maharashtra
- Permanent
- Full-time
- Develop and execute automated test scripts for functional, regression, integration, and performance testing.
- Define automation architecture and best practices for finance products.
- Lead automation planning, execution, and continuous improvement initiatives.
- Manage stakeholder communication and provide technical leadership.
- Oversee test environment management and regression suite maintenance.
- Work closely with developers, product owners, and manual testers in Agile/Scrum environments to understand requirements and define test scenarios.
- Guide and mentor junior QA engineers in automation best practices, coding standards, testing processes and review automation scripts.
- Develop, maintain, and upgrade automated test scripts, utilities, simulators, data sets and other programmatic test tools required to execute test plans.
- Execute functional and regression tests.
- Triage, log, and track defects to closure, performing root cause analysis (RCA) on failed tests to differentiate between bugs and environment issues.
- Work on automation on various products with the team whenever needed.
- Ability to meet deadlines and work independently.
- Perform manual testing as per requirements.
- Work with BA to understand functionality and work independently during testing life cycle.
- Architect, enhance, and maintain robust, scalable, and reusable test automation frameworks (e.g., Page Object Model, Keyword-driven, BDD/Cucumber) for web, mobile, or API applications.
- 8–12 years of experience in QA automation.
- Strong hands-on experience in Java, Python, JavaScript, etc.
- Expertise in Selenium WebDriver, Cypress, Playwright, Appium, or TestNG/JUnit.
- Proficiency in Rest Assured, Postman, or Swagger.
- Experience with
- Knowledge of SQL and NoSQL databases for backend validation.
- Proven ability to design modular, reusable automation frameworks.
- Ability to drive innovation and mentor large teams.
- Understanding on other market standard automation tools like: playwright, UFT etc
- Experience in Agile methodology and test management tools.
- Good understanding of Finance domain processes and products.
- Good Knowledge of GIT/SVN, Jira and Agile practices
- Good knowledge of SDLC, defect lifecycle, testing methodology.
- Excellent hand-on in Microsoft excel and word
- Understanding of AI and implementation approaches.
- In-depth understanding of Finance domain processes and products.
- Experience with performance testing tools (JMeter).
- BDD Cucumber, Gherkin.
- Familiarity with tools that use AI to reduce test maintenance, such as Testim, Mabl, etc
- Security Testing- Basic knowledge of testing for vulnerabilities.
- Fluent in English
- Excellent communicator – ability to discuss technical and commercial solutions to internal and external parties and adapt depending on the technical or business focus of the discussion
- Attention to detail – track record of authoring high quality documentation
- Organized approach – manage and adapt priorities according to client and internal requirements
- Self-starter but team mindset - work autonomously and as part of a global team